Yes, some European kings and royal institutions still use wax seals on official documents, though it is more ceremonial than practical today. Wax seals historically served as a means of authentication and security, and they continue to symbolize tradition and legitimacy in royal communications. While modern technology has largely replaced the need for wax seals, they are often used for special occasions and formal documents.
